Equation f ( p ( x ) ) = q ( f ( x ) ) for given real functions p , q

Oldřich Kopeček (2012)

Czechoslovak Mathematical Journal

We investigate functional equations f ( p ( x ) ) = q ( f ( x ) ) where p and q are given real functions defined on the set of all real numbers. For these investigations, we can use methods for constructions of homomorphisms of mono-unary algebras. Our considerations will be confined to functions p , q which are strictly increasing and continuous on . In this case, there is a simple characterization for the existence of a solution of the above equation. First, we give such a characterization. Further, we present a construction...

Equational bases for weak monounary varieties

Grzegorz Bińczak (2002)

Discussiones Mathematicae - General Algebra and Applications

It is well-known that every monounary variety of total algebras has one-element equational basis (see [5]). In my paper I prove that every monounary weak variety has at most 3-element equational basis. I give an example of monounary weak variety having 3-element equational basis, which has no 2-element equational basis.
